WebAug 27, 2024 · Create a homemade car freshener with one cup of baking soda and five drops of your favorite essential oil. Place both the soda and oil in a sealable plastic bag or glass jar for 24 hours. Then shake it up, sprinkle on the car’s floor and let it sit for 20 minutes. When the time has passed, vacuum up the baking soda. WebMay 7, 2024 · Local dealers want you to bring your car to them to have it detailed. WebJun 15, 2024 · Household Products to Clean Car's Dashboard Vinegar If you notice stains on your dashboard, one of the easiest solutions you can use to clean this consists of a mixture of water and vinegar in the ratio of 1:3. The solution is placed inside the spray bottle for easy application on the dash.
